These are some of the ways to block out light from coming through the door. If you don't mind hanging a curtain, you search for blackout cloth.If the light is bleeding through the bottom, you use door draft blockers to block it.This solution is more applicable to the door frame. Use weathering strips to block areas that are leaking light.
